Undeleting files and folders
If you want to recover a file or folder you’ve deleted from
your computer, you can use the Mirra to undelete it and
restore it to its original location on your computer.
On the Backup & Restore screen, backed up files and
folders that have been deleted from your computer are
displayed with a line through them (Figure 8).

Step 1: Select the file or folder you wish to undelete.
Step 2: On the Restore Tasks menu, click Undelete
file (or Undelete folder). The deleted file or folder
is automatically restored to its original location on
your computer.
Restoring a previous version of a file
Your Mirra automatically saves up to eight versions of
each backed up file. You can restore any version to its
original location on your computer.
Step 1: On the Backup & Restore screen, double-click
the file to be restored. The history for the file, including
previously saved versions, is displayed (Figure 9).

Step 2: Select the version of the file you want to restore.
Step 3: On the Version Tasks menu, click Restore
selected version. The file is automatically restored to
its original location on your computer.
